Verify identity list steps. Cot(t)(1-cos^2(t))=cos(t)sin(t)
storchak [24]
Remember: We have to work from either the LHS or the RHS.
(Left hand side or the Right hand side)

You should already know this:

\huge{Cot(t) = \frac{1}{tan(t)} = \frac{1}{\frac{sin(t)}{cos(t)}} = 1\div \frac{sin(t)}{cos(t)} = 1\times \frac{cos(t)}{sin(t)}=\boxed{\frac{cos(t)}{sin(t)}}


You should also know this:

sin^2(t) + cos^2(t) = 1\\\\\boxed{sin^2(t)} = 1 - cos^2(t)

So plugging in both of those into our identity, we get:

\frac{cos(t)}{sin(t)}\cdot sin^2(t) = cos(t)\cdot sin(t)

Simplify the denominator on the LHS (Left Hand Side)

We get:

cos(t) \cdot sin(t) = cos(t) \cdot sin(t)

LHS = RHS

Therefore, identity is verified.
